A nanophotonic platform integrating quantum memories and single rare-earth ions

Abstract

We demonstrate a quantum nanophotonic platform integrating on-chip quantum memories and optically addressable single rare-earth ions. We show near-transform-limited, high-purity single photon emissions from individual rare-earth ions.
